Transfer data from Old Samsung Phone to New Samsung Phone
Learn how to use transfer data easily from Old Samsung phone to New Samsung phone in few taps.

If you’ve purchased a new Samsung phone and using it first time, then you must go through this complete Samsung phone guide.
Transferring data to your new Samsung phone is now made easier with Smart Switch feature.
Use Smart Switch™ to transfer contacts, photos, music, videos, messages, notes, calendars, and more from your old device. Smart Switch can transfer your data via USB cable, Wi-Fi, or computer.
- From Settings, tap Accounts and backup > Smart Switch.
- Follow the prompts and select the content to transfer.
Transferring content with a USB cable may increase battery consumption. Make sure your battery is fully charged.

Samsung Phone Lock, Unlock, & Security
Learn how to lock and unlock your Samsung phone. Learn how to protect your Samsung phone with its built-in security features.

Use Samsung phone’s screen lock features to secure your device. By default, the mobile phone locks automatically when the screen times out.
- Press mobile side key or button to lock your phone.
- Press to turn on the screen, and then swipe the screen to unlock it.
Samsung Screen Lock & Security Features
You can secure your phone and protect your data by setting a screen lock.
Understand Screen Lock Types
You can choose from the following screen lock types that offer high, medium, or no security: –
- Swipe Lock
- Pattern Lock
- PIN Lock
- Password Lock
- None

Samsung Bixby Virtual Assistant Guide
Learn how to use Samsung Bixby Virtual Assistant in any Samsung Mobile Phone for Camera, Gallery, & Internet.

Samsung Bixby is a virtual assistant that learns, evolves, and adapts to you. It learns your routines, helps you set up reminders based on time and location, and is built in to your favorite apps.
- From a Home screen, press and hold the Side key.
You can also access Bixby from the Apps list.
Samsung Bixby Routines
You can use Samsung Bixby to show you information or change device settings based on where you are and what you are doing.
- From Settings, tap Advanced features > Bixby Routines.
Samsung Bixby Vision
Bixby is integrated with your Samsung phone camera, gallery, and internet apps to give you a deeper understanding of what you see. It provides contextual icons for translation, QR code detection, landmark recognition, or shopping.
Bixby Camera
Bixby Vision is available on the Samsung Phone Camera viewfinder to help understand what you see. From Camera, tap More > Bixby Vision and follow the prompts.
Bixby Gallery
Bixby Vision can be used on pictures and images saved in the Gallery app.
- From Gallery, tap a picture to view it.
- Tap Bixby Vision and follow the prompts.
Bixby Internet
Samsung Bixby Vision can help you find out more about an image you find in the Samsung Internet app.
- From Internet, touch and hold an image until a pop-up menu is displayed.
- Tap Bixby Vision and follow the prompts.

Turn on your Samsung phone
Use the Side key to turn your device on. Do not use the device if the body is cracked or broken. Use the device only after it has been repaired.
- Press and hold the Side key to turn the device on.
- To turn the device off, open the Notification panel, and tap Power > Power off. Confirm when prompted.
- To restart your device, open the Notification panel, and tap Power > Restart. Confirm when prompted.
You can also turn your device off by pressing the Side and Volume down keys at the same time.
To learn more about powering off your device from Settings, tap Advanced features > Side key > How to power off your phone.
Use the Samsung Phone Setup Wizard
The first time you turn your phone on, the Setup Wizard guides you through the basics of setting up your device.
Follow the prompts to choose a default language, connect to a Wi-Fi® network, set up accounts, choose location services, learn about your device’s features, and more.

Using Samsung Dust & Water Resistant Phones
Learn how to maintain dust and water resistance feature and result quality on Samsung phones.
Several Samsung phone devices are IP68 rated dust and water resistant.
To maintain the water-resistant and dust-resistant features of your device, make sure that the SIM card/Memory card tray openings are maintained free of dust and water, and the tray is securely inserted prior to any exposure to liquids.
